Output 52f950a74703286e71103175e1f6a524b577b5d8321580313e393186ede3fb58:1

value
9884132
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fbf9ed87a995e9a907501bc79f9efc36b83203d1 OP_EQUALVERIFY OP_CHECKSIG
address
1PyL1SaSxjAQJtunjWivCJpqDh3WWMtj42
transaction
52f950a74703286e71103175e1f6a524b577b5d8321580313e393186ede3fb58
confirmations
468873
spent
true